A Child Trust Fund (CTF) is a savings (Cash) or investment (Stocks and Shares) account that launched in January 2005 and was available for children born between 1st September 2002 and 2nd January 2011. Child Trust Funds are long term, tax-free savings accounts for children that were set up by the Government in 2005. Income and gains earned within both a CTF and JISA are exempt from UK income tax and UK capital gains tax, so the reasons to transfer may be decided more on other factors such as type of products a provider offers, your risk appetite and the fees charged.
